Установка
В этом разделе описаны способы установки библиотек GigaChain и GigaServe, а так же консольной утилиты GigaChain CLI.
Установка GigaChain
- Менеджер пакетов
- Из исходников
Для установки GigaChain используйте менеджер пакетов pip:
pip install gigachain
Пакет gigachain
содержит миниальный набор инструментов, необходимый для работы GigaChain.
Зависимости, которые обеспечивают интеграцию с различными моделями и сервисами, нужно устанавливать отдельно.
Для установки из исходников:
Склонируйте репозиторий.
Перейдите в папку библиотеки:
cd путь/к/репозиторию/gigachain/libs/langchain
Выполните команду
pip install -e .
Экспериментальная версия GigaChain
Экспериментальная версия GigaChain содержит код, предназначенный для проверки идей, исследований и опытов. Для установки используйте менеджер пакетов:
pip install gigachain-experimental
GigaChain CLI
Консольная утилита GigaChain CLI упрощает работу с GigaChain и GigaServe. В частности, с ее помощью вы можете легко установить сертификаты Минцифры
Для установки GigaChain CLI используйте менеджер пакетов pip:
pip install gigachain-cli
GigaServe
Библиотека GigaServe позволяет организовать доступ к runnable-интерфейсам GigaChain в виде REST API. GigaServe устанаваливается автоматически при установке GigaChain CLI.
Для самостоятельной установки библиотеки используйте менеджер пакетов pip:
pip install "gigaserve[all]"
Команда устанавливает клиентскую и серверную части библиотеки.
Для отдельной установки клиентской части используйте команду:
pip install "gigaserve[client]"
Для отдельной установки серверной части используйте команду:
pip install "gigaserve[server]"
Миграция с LangChain
Для миграции с LangChain и начала использования GigaChain нужно удалить все компоненты библиотеки langchain
:
pip uninstall langchain langchain_experimental langchain_core langchain_community
После чего установить библиотеку gigachain
:
pip install gigachain